Deep purple. Meat and tobacco on the nose. On the palate high alcohol, medium acidity, full body. Chocolate, black cherries, black plums, black pepper, sage. Still drinking young. A bit hot and a bit sweet for my palate, but still delicious.

This bottle was especially good; even better on day 2. Fruit; acid, mouthfeel and tannin were all in super balance. Briary berries, big full and complex fruit on the middle and a superb tannic and briary fruit on the finish. Once again, I have found that Matt Cline's Zins continue to develop years after bottling. I give this wine another ten years of great life with a peak in another year or two.

This bottle sung with lots of blueberry and blackberry fruit. It had lots of prickly spice and a full mouth. finish had nice vanilla oak and fruit finish. I drank this after a quite nice Barbaresco and it totally overwhelmed the performance of that vey good wine.

I expected more. Nice briary fruit and crisp acidity (maybe too much). Mouth feel is very big and full but it weighs in a bit hot (not alcoholic Heat). The medium weight tingly tannin is muted by the fruit that hangs on in the finish...I'd rather get that tannin a bit more. 11 more bottles, let's see how it develops.

Fruity, spicy and layered. The complexity shows mostly on the mid palate. I quite enjoyed the spice with several different cheeses
